Another factor that makes the four-post lift appealing to certain homeowners is its mobility. Unlike the more permanent two-post lift, which is typically anchored into the ground, a four-post lift can be moved around the garage with the use of a caster kit. This mobility is particularly beneficial for homeowners who need to create more flexible space in their garage or for those who may need to relocate the lift for different tasks. The ability to move the lift allows for a more adaptable garage layout, enabling the homeowner to use their space in a way that fits their needs over time. In contrast, a two-post lift is often fixed in place, limiting the flexibility of the garage’s layout.

When considering the design and functionality of a garage, most people naturally assume that the size of the garage directly correlates to the number of vehicles it can accommodate. The basic logic is that a one-car garage can house a single vehicle, while a two-car garage should fit two vehicles. In theory, this seems like a simple equation—more space equals more vehicles. However, the reality of maximizing garage space isn’t quite as straightforward as it may appear at first glance.
While expanding the physical dimensions of your garage to create more parking space is one possible approach, it’s not the only solution. In fact, you can significantly increase the parking capacity of your garage without undergoing a massive renovation or tearing down walls. One innovative and practical solution that many homeowners are increasingly turning to is the addition of a four-post car lift. This clever garage addition makes it possible to park multiple vehicles in a single garage without the need for significant construction or costly renovations.
A Mobile Column Lift For Sale Buckeye AZ four-post car lift operates by utilizing a hydraulic system to raise one vehicle off the ground, allowing you to use the floor space beneath it for additional storage or for parking a second vehicle. By making use of your garage’s vertical space, which often goes underutilized, a car lift can effectively double the available parking area. This solution is particularly useful for those who need to park more vehicles than their garage was originally designed to accommodate but are not in a position to undergo major structural changes to their home.
